Overview
Maryvale Middle School, located in 1050 Maryvale Dr Cheektowaga , NY 14225-2386, serves 471 students with a student/teacher ratio of 10.7. It belongs to Cheektowaga-Maryvale Union Free School District and ranks 814th of 1,479 New York Middle Schools.
